Smart Weather Condition Sensors
Smart weather condition sensors have reinvented the effectiveness of contemporary irrigation systems by adjusting watering timetables based upon real-time ecological data. These sensors keep track of variables such as temperature, humidity, wind rate, and solar radiation, allowing systems to react dynamically to transforming weather. By incorporating this information, smart sensors can optimize water use, lowering waste and ensuring that landscapes obtain the proper amount of moisture. This technology not only preserves water however likewise promotes much healthier plant growth by preventing overwatering or underwatering. In addition, the automation supplied by smart climate sensors boosts user convenience, as landscapers and house owners can rely on precise watering schedules without hand-operated treatment. In general, these advancements stand for a substantial innovation in sustainable watering methods.

Soil Wetness Sensors
Soil wetness sensing units play a necessary function in modern irrigation systems, giving real-time data that improves water performance. These devices determine the volumetric water web content in the soil, enabling for exact analyses of moisture levels. By incorporating dirt moisture sensors into watering systems, customers can stay clear of overwatering or underwatering, ultimately promoting healthier plant development and preserving water resources.The sensing units transmit data to controllers, which can adjust watering routines based on present dirt problems. This data-driven strategy reduces water waste and guarantees that plants receive the very best quantity of wetness. In addition, dirt dampness sensing units can be beneficial in various agricultural settings, from home gardens to large-scale farms. The deployment of these sensors adds to sustainable practices by supporting responsible water use and reducing environmental impact. Overall, the incorporation of dirt moisture sensing units notes a substantial innovation in attaining reliable watering systems.
